Curitiba (CWB) to Rio Verde (RVD)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Afonso Pena Airport (CWB) in Curitiba, Brazil to General Leite de Castro Airport (RVD) in Rio Verde, Brazil is 876 kilometers (544 miles / 473 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ying north northwest at a heading of 348°.

This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.

This is a domestic route within Brazil.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ation.

Time zone information: When it's 15:36 in Curitiba, it's 15:36 in Rio Verde.

The return flight from Rio Verde (RVD) to Curitiba (CWB) follows a heading of 168° (south southe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
